Yes. This was my first thought as well. I'm not aware of any heat or basking light that come in the form of a coil or compact. Moreover, the household type coils are of the "energy saver" type and do not put out much heat (but are fine to use for extra light in the enclosure if needed). I would have your sister find out the exact origin of the bulb, and also gauge temps (with probe thermometer) to be sure. My feeling is, if the bulb was bought at a pet store, there is a good chance it's not a heat lamp, but a "highly suspect" UVB and therefore, should be removed. If it's a household coil, then it's not putting out much heat, only light... which is fine so long as she has another bright white heat lamp source which is providing proper temps for the enclosure.

Well thats fine to use then just make sure she is aware that beardies need bright white light for basking suring the day so having just a CE isnt adequate for daytime basking.Thats good news that he pooped.I am happy he is doing better :D
